On average across the year,
no, Belarus is not hotter than
Windsor, Ontario
.
Belarus has an average temperature of 8°C/46°F and Windsor, Ontario has an average temperature of 11°C/52°F.
Belarus's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 26°C/79°F, which is not hotter than Windsor, Ontario's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F).
On average across the year, yes, Belarus is colder than Windsor, Ontario . Belarus has an average minimum temperature of 4°C/39°F and Windsor, Ontario has an average minimum temperature of 6°C/43°F.
